Christmas sign

 Last week I made a Christmas sign using a black frame (Ribba) from IKEA.

I took the backside of the frame - which is made of masonite - and painted it with plack acrylic paint mixed with plaster of paris and a little water to make the paint more chalky and resemble a black board. Then I cut out the image from sign vinyl, using my Silhouette Cameo and took away the cut out pattern, making it a stencil, and placed that on the dried board. The first layer was black - to make sure that if the paint would bleed it would bleed the background color and hence not be visible, and after that two layers of white acrylic paint. 

The image is from Etsy, but I added the sentence Wonderful toys for good little boys since my grand kids are lovely little lads :).



I am really pleased with the outcome. The Cameo machine has brought so much joy lately, I can't understand why I haven't used it more...

Roses on kraft and my new machine

 Today I have a Christmas card to show, a Chocolate Baroque stamp on craft paper, coloured with wax crayons. The stamp is so detailed it actually took me three attempts to get it right, ssshhh don't tell anyone :)

And I have bought myself a proper heat press so now I cut and press vinyl on more or less everything. It's so fun and the result is amazing. I used to use a regular iron to press on the stuff I cut with my Silhouette Cameo and was quite happy with that but the difference is out of this world!
